How to connect AI: Perplexity and Systeme IO

Create a New Scenario to Connect AI: Perplexity and Systeme IO

In the workspace, click the “Create New Scenario” button.

Add the First Step

Add the first node – a trigger that will initiate the scenario when it receives the required event. Triggers can be scheduled, called by a AI: Perplexity, triggered by another scenario, or executed manually (for testing purposes). In most cases, AI: Perplexity or Systeme IO will be your first step. To do this, click "Choose an app," find AI: Perplexity or Systeme IO, and select the appropriate trigger to start the scenario.

Add the AI: Perplexity Node

Select the AI: Perplexity node from the app selection panel on the right.

Save and Activate the Scenario

After configuring AI: Perplexity, Systeme IO, and any additional nodes, don’t forget to save the scenario and click "Deploy." Activating the scenario ensures it will run automatically whenever the trigger node receives input or a condition is met. By default, all newly created scenarios are deactivated.

Test the Scenario

Run the scenario by clicking “Run once” and triggering an event to check if the AI: Perplexity and Systeme IO integration works as expected. Depending on your setup, data should flow between AI: Perplexity and Systeme IO (or vice versa). Easily troubleshoot the scenario by reviewing the execution history to identify and fix any issues.

Most powerful ways to connect AI: Perplexity and Systeme IO

Systeme IO + AI: Perplexity + Discord bot: When a new event occurs in Systeme IO (e.g., a new course is created), a chat completion is created in Perplexity AI to generate research insights. These insights are then shared on a specified Discord channel.

Systeme IO + AI: Perplexity + Google Sheets: When a new event occurs in Systeme IO (e.g. a new sign-up), Perplexity AI creates a chat completion to generate a learning summary. This summary, along with sign-up information, is then added to a Google Sheet.

How secure is the AI: Perplexity integration on Latenode?

Latenode uses advanced encryption and secure authentication protocols, protecting your data during AI: Perplexity and Systeme IO data transfer.

Are there any limitations to the AI: Perplexity and Systeme IO integration on Latenode?

While the integration is powerful, there are certain limitations to be aware of:

  • Rate limits imposed by AI: Perplexity and Systeme IO may affect workflow speed.
  • Complex AI: Perplexity queries might require optimized prompts for best results.
  • Custom data transformations may require JavaScript knowledge.
